Wildomar is a city in Riverside County, California, United States. It was incorporated on July 1, 2008. [cite web | title=Riverside County Community of Wildomar Holds Cityhood Fireworks Celebration | url=http://www.scpr.org/news/stories/2008/07/01/18_new_riv_co_city_0701.html | publisher=KPCC | date=2008-07-01 | accessdate=2008-07-17] The population of Wildomar was 14,064 at the 2000 census, when the community was still an unincorporated census-designated place.

History

Wildomar was originally established in the late 1880s by Donald Graham, his wife Margaret Collier and her ex-husband William Collier(Mr. Collier was the first mayor of the City of South Pasadena). After Margaret divorced William, she met and married Donald Graham, then moved to what is now the southern edge of the Lake Elsinore Valley to establish the small town named as an anagram of their first names(WILliam Collier, DOnald Graham and MARgaret Collier Graham).

In an election held February 5, 2008, Measure C to incorporate Wildomar passed by a nearly 3-2 margin. [cite web | title=WILDOMAR: The Birthing of a City | url=http://www.redcounty.com/riverside/2008/04/wildomar-the-birthing-of-a-cit/ | date=2008-04-02 | accessdate=2008-07-17] Wildomar was officially incorporated on July 1, 2008 as the 25th city in Riverside County.

Geography

Wildomar is located at coor dms|33|36|27|N|117|15|37|W|city (33.607460, -117.260193)GR|1.

According to the United States Census Bureau, the community has a total area of 13.2 square miles (34.3 km²), all of it land.

Demographics

As of the censusGR|2 of 2000, there were 14,064 people, 4,572 households, and 3,694 families residing in the community. The population density was 1,063.1 people per square mile (410.4/km²). There were 4,772 housing units at an average density of 360.7/sq mi (139.3/km²). The racial makeup of the community was 82.05% White, 1.76% African American, 0.90% Native American, 1.84% Asian, 0.26% Pacific Islander, 9.14% from other races, and 4.05% from two or more races. Hispanic or Latino of any race were 21.58% of the population.

There were 4,572 households out of which 40.3% had children under the age of 18 living with them, 67.4% were married couples living together, 9.4% had a female householder with no husband present, and 19.2% were non-families. 14.6% of all households were made up of individuals and 7.3% had someone living alone who was 65 years of age or older. The average household size was 3.06 and the average family size was 3.38.

The population is spread out with 30.2% under the age of 18, 6.8% from 18 to 24, 28.7% from 25 to 44, 20.6% from 45 to 64, and 13.8% who were 65 years of age or older. The median age was 36 years. For every 100 females there were 98.2 males. For every 100 females age 18 and over, there were 94.8 males.

The median income for a household in the community was $49,081, and the median income for a family was $51,964. Males had a median income of $42,549 versus $30,262 for females. The per capita income for the community was $20,190. About 6.3% of families and 8.2% of the population were below the poverty line, including 10.3% of those under age 18 and 2.8% of those age 65 or over.

Politics

In the state legislature Wildomar is located in the 36th Senate District, represented by Republican Dennis Hollingsworth, and in the 64th and 66th Assembly Districts, represented by Republicans John J. Benoit and Kevin Jeffries respectively. Federally, Wildomar is located in California's 49th congressional district, which has a Cook PVI of R +10 [cite web | title = Will Gerrymandered Districts Stem the Wave of Voter Unrest? | publisher = Campaign Legal Center Blog | url=http://www.clcblog.org/blog_item-85.html | accessdate = 2008-02-10] and is represented by Republican Darrell Issa.

"Southwest Healthcare System-Wildomar" is a General Acute Care Hospital in Wildomar with Basic Emergency Services and a Level III Trauma Center as of 2005. [California Department of Health Services]

Public Safety

The Riverside County Sheriff's Department's Lake Elsinore Valley Regional Station will assign deputies to the new City shortly, while CAL-FIRE(California Department of Forestry and Fire Prevention) already has two stations in Wildomar.
